Digital Asset Technical Director
The Digital Asset Technical Director will bring their experience and expertise to help lead character and rigging development for LAL projects. This role is responsible for supporting the planning, creation, and review of high-quality character assets and rigs used across company shows and productions. Working closely with the story and animation teams, the Technical Director will guide the development of character assets to meet specific aesthetic and performance requirements. Additionally, they will collaborate with external vendors’ rigging and animation teams to ensure alignment across all studios, maintaining rigging consistency and efficiency throughout the animation pipeline.
CG Supervisor
The CG Supervisor’s primary goal is to work closely with the Cinematography Lighting & VFX Director and the production leads as a member of a small team of technicians and artists to collaborate with an overseas team for shot production. A major portion of the role is to align and continually communicate with all internal departments, and to assist in developing pipeline tools, to perform animation enhancements and look development that meets the needs of the show for both internal and overseas teams.
Color Key Artist
Under the artistic supervision of the Supervising Director, Art Director, Lighting Director, and Senior Color Key Artist, the Color Key Artist will paint lighting keys using still frames from animatics as guidelines for 3D Lighters on an animated television series. Additionally, assist the Digimatte team in creating mattes and background elements for use in final shot production.
